Burnley vs Newcastle promises to be a thrilling battle at Turf Moor tonight as two teams desperate for points clash in a crucial Premier League encounter. Both sides seek redemption before the new year, with Burnley fighting to escape the relegation zone and Newcastle aiming to climb the table.

Burnley’s Desperate Struggle to Survive

Burnley enter tonight’s clash in 19th position, deeply entrenched in a relegation fight. The Clarets face up to nine players unavailable due to injuries, creating significant squad depth problems. Manager Scott Parker must inspire a response after difficult weeks of results.

The hosts have shown resilience despite mounting pressure. Burnley claimed a vital 2-1 victory over Aston Villa earlier this month, proving they can compete against quality opposition. Tonight offers another opportunity to build momentum before entering 2026.

At home, Burnley traditionally enjoy better results at Turf Moor. The familiar surroundings could provide the boost needed against a Newcastle team carrying injury concerns of their own.

Newcastle’s Away Day Vulnerability

Newcastle United sit in 14th position but possess the quality to climb significantly. However, manager Eddie Howe faces an away-day crisis with multiple defensive injuries limiting his options. Defenders Sven Botman, Kieran Trippier, Dan Burn, Tino Livramento, Jamaal Lascelles, and Emil Krafth are ruled out, forcing tactical adjustments.

Newcastle ended their historic 56-year wait for a major trophy in 2025, marking an incredible achievement. Recent form included impressive victories before a setback against Manchester United. Away from St James’ Park, they’ve shown vulnerabilities that Burnley will target aggressively.

The Magpies dominated recent Burnley fixtures, winning 5 of their last 5 meetings in all competitions at both halftime and fulltime. This dominance suggests tactical superiority, yet injuries threaten that advantage tonight.

Burnley will attempt to exploit Newcastle‘s defensive absences by pushing forward through the wings. Jaidon Anthony becomes crucial for creating chances. Newcastle rely on midfield control through Bruno Guimarães and Sander Tonali to dominate possession and dictate play.

Injury Updates That Could Decide Everything

Burnley face a severe squad shortage with midfielder Josh Cullen doubtful after knee injury in Saturday’s draw against Everton. Maxime Esteve also carries doubt status. The club previously reported Zeki Amdouni and Jordan Beyer as definite absences, testing squad depth severely.

Newcastle have slight hope with Nick Pope possibly returning, though confirmed absences include William Osula and Alexander Elanga. The defensive injuries force Eddie Howe to experiment tactically, potentially weakening their reliable structured approach that dominated 2025.
